1. The Historical Context of Mexican Cinema

Mexican cinema has a rich and vibrant history that dates back to the early 20th century. The early films often reflected the social and political climate of the time, with themes that resonated with the Mexican populace. The Golden Age of Mexican cinema in the 1940s and 1950s saw a surge in the popularity of films and actors, laying the groundwork for future generations of filmmakers and actresses.

During this era, actresses such as María Félix and Dolores del Río emerged as iconic figures, captivating audiences with their performances. They not only became symbols of beauty and talent but also represented the struggles and aspirations of Mexican women in a rapidly changing society.

Today, the legacy of these pioneering actresses continues to inspire new talent, as the industry evolves and diversifies. The historical context provides a backdrop for understanding the significance of contemporary Mexican actresses in both national and international cinema.

3. The Impact of Mexican Actresses on Hollywood

Mexican actresses have increasingly made their presence felt in Hollywood, challenging stereotypes and redefining roles for Latinx characters. Their impact is evident in various productions that highlight Mexican culture and narratives.

Actresses like Salma Hayek and Sofia Vergara have paved the way for future generations, demonstrating that talent knows no borders. Their success stories encourage aspiring actresses to pursue their dreams, regardless of the challenges they may face.

Furthermore, collaborations between Mexican actresses and renowned directors, such as Guillermo del Toro and Alfonso Cuarón, have led to critically acclaimed films that showcase the richness of Mexican storytelling.

5. The Cultural Significance of Mexican Actresses

Mexican actresses play a vital role in promoting and preserving Mexican culture through their work. They bring stories to life that reflect the complexities of Mexican identity, often addressing social issues and cultural nuances.

Their performances can serve as a bridge between cultures, fostering understanding and appreciation for Mexican heritage. Additionally, by showcasing the diversity within Mexico itself, these actresses challenge monolithic representations of Latinx individuals in media.
